How Much Does It Cost to Charge a Lucid Air in New Jersey?
Quick Answer
Charging a 2026 Lucid Air at home in New Jersey costs approximately $41/month — that's $0.041/mile and saves $1,004/year compared to a 28 MPG gas car at New Jersey's gas price of $3.50/gallon.

About the 2026 Lucid Air
The Lucid Air holds the record for the longest range of any production EV — up to 516 miles in the Grand Touring configuration. Designed by ex-Tesla engineers and using technology derived from Formula E, it achieves 4.6 mi/kWh efficiency that no competitor approaches.
Range-obsessed buyers who need 400+ miles for long road trips between charging stops. Tech enthusiasts who want the most advanced EV powertrain ever built. Buyers who don't mind being early adopters of a smaller brand.
Competes with Tesla Model S, Mercedes EQS, and BMW i7. Gas equivalent would be a Mercedes S-Class at approximately 22 MPG.
Lucid Air Charging Cost Breakdown in New Jersey
New Jersey's electricity rate of $0.19/kWh is above the national average of $0.17/kWh. At this rate, the Lucid Air's 112 kWh battery costs $21.28 for a full charge — a meaningful savings versus gas at current prices.
Based on 1,000 miles/month. Public L2 estimated at 1.8× home rate. DC fast charging at national average of $0.49/kWh.
2026 Lucid AirSpecs & Charging Data
300 kW DC fast charging. 10–80% in approximately 22 minutes at a 350 kW charger — among the fastest of any luxury EV. Level 2 at home (19.2 kW onboard charger) fully charges the 112 kWh battery in approximately 5.5 hours.
EV Ownership in New Jersey
New Jersey has strong EV adoption, particularly in the NYC commuter suburbs. High gas prices, access to the Turnpike fast-charging network, and strong state incentives make NJ a favorable EV market.
New Jersey's Charge Up NJ program offers rebates up to $4,000. PSE&G offers Level 2 charger rebates and EV charging programs. No state sales tax on EVs (as of the Clean Energy Act) further reduces upfront costs.
The NJ Turnpike and Garden State Parkway have growing DCFC coverage. Northern NJ has excellent urban charging density. Atlantic City and Shore areas are growing. South Jersey has moderate coverage.
New Jersey's grid draws from PJM — mix of nuclear (~37%, including Salem and Hope Creek plants), natural gas (~35%), and growing renewables. NJ has aggressive offshore wind goals (7.5 GW by 2035) that will clean the grid significantly.

Tips for Charging Your Lucid Air in New Jersey
New Jersey's moderate climate and charging infrastructure have specific implications for Lucid Air owners. Here are practical tips to maximize range and minimize charging costs in this state:
PSE&G's EV charging plan offers off-peak rates around $0.09–0.11/kWh — a significant discount from NJ's otherwise high electricity costs.
Turnpike rest stops have growing DCFC infrastructure — convenient for I-95 corridor travelers.
NJ's no-sales-tax on EVs saves $2,000–$8,000 at purchase — one of the best at-purchase incentives in the Northeast.
Newark and Jersey City residents without home charging: ChargePoint and BLINK have growing Level 2 networks in urban garages.
